## Approvals: Websocket Reconnect Fix

This page tracks sign-off for the patch addressing the reconnect storm in the Pondbridge gateway, where dropped websocket sessions retried without backoff and overwhelmed the edge nodes. The fix adds jittered exponential backoff and caps concurrent reconnect attempts per client. QA has verified behavior under simulated network flaps, and load testing passed on staging. Before we schedule the rollout, we need one final approval per our change policy. The approver responsible for this change is named below.

account owner for tawip-kahop: Oliok Jorix Ulaath Quenok

Vendor note: Brackenfeld's Relayline SDK drops websocket connections after token refresh and retries with the stale token, producing auth loops under load. We have reproduced this on their staging tier and shared traces. A patched build is promised within two weeks; until then we hold the upgrade. Questions or new reproductions should go to their integration desk at the address below.

escalation mailbox, bafog-fafog: ulador@paliqlabs.internal

# Signing Grafton-Prof Artifacts

All releases of Grafton-Prof, our GPU memory profiling toolkit, must be signed before upload to the Velloway artifact store. Maintainers should verify the build hash against the CI manifest first, then sign both the tarball and the checksum file. Unsigned builds are rejected automatically. The current release signing key is as follows.

release key, fajef-kajeg: bky19_LdLu6Ne6FLi8he2c24d

Handover — Tallygrove billing worker

Taking over from me as of Monday. Blue-green is live: blue serves, green is staged with the new proration fix. Don't promote green until the invoice backfill finishes. Health checks gate the flip automatically; if they flap, abort, don't force. Review the pending PR against the green branch only. Cutover checklist and flip history are documented here.

wiki page, kageg-fawip: https://jira.tolvaqsys.internal/projects/pages/pages/a21b2f71